Key Topics to Revise

1

1. Totipotency

  • Totipotency refers to the ability of a single plant cell to divide and differentiate into a complete plant under suitable conditions.
  • The term was first coined by Morgan in 1901 to describe regenerative capacity.
  • This concept is the foundation of plant tissue culture because any living plant cell can potentially regenerate into a full plant.
2

2. Steps in Plant Tissue Culture

  • The process involves six main steps: preparation of nutrient medium, sterilization, explant preparation, inoculation, incubation, and acclimatization.
  • Each step must be performed under sterile conditions to prevent contamination.
  • The success of tissue culture depends on precise control of nutrients, hormones, temperature, and light.
3

3. Nutrient Medium and Growth Regulators

  • The nutrient medium provides all essential elements for plant growth in vitro.
  • MS medium (Murashige and Skoog) is the most commonly used medium.
  • It contains macro and micronutrients, vitamins, amino acids, and carbohydrates like sucrose.
4

4. Organogenesis and Somatic Embryogenesis

  • Organogenesis is the formation of organs (roots or shoots) from callus.
  • High auxin : low cytokinin ratio promotes root formation (rhizogenesis).
  • Low auxin : high cytokinin ratio promotes shoot formation (caulogenesis).
